This immaculate two-bedroom semi-detached bungalow sits on a raised corner plot in Patcham, offering tidy, move-in-ready accommodation for downsizers or small families. Recent three-year refurbishment has refreshed the interior with white plaster walls, wood-effect laminate flooring and modern kitchen and bathroom fittings, so the property is ready to occupy with minimal immediate works.
The layout is compact and practical: two bay-fronted bedrooms, a living room, kitchen with separate utility area, and a small conservatory that brings extra light. The rear garden faces south and is enclosed, providing a pleasant private space for relaxing or low-maintenance gardening. A detached garage with power and lighting plus a private driveway give useful off-street parking.
Notable potential includes loft conversion subject to necessary planning and building regulations (STNC), which could add valuable living space. Practical details to note: total internal area is modest (approx. 589 sq ft), double glazing was installed before 2002, and broadband speeds vary (Superfast 62 Mbps commonly available; ultrafast available in some areas). Council Tax sits in Band C, considered affordable for the area.
Overall this bungalow suits buyers seeking a well-presented, easy-care home in a very low-crime, affluent neighbourhood with good local schools and green space nearby. The compact size and semi-detached form mean anyone wanting significantly more living space should factor in the loft conversion or other extensions subject to permissions.
